VIDEO2 & 3 COMPONENT JACKS: Connection Option 2 CONNECTING A DVD PLAYER 1 Connect a Component Cable to the VIDEO3 Green, Blue, and Red video jacks. 2 Connect an Audio Cable to the matching VIDEO3 White and Red audio jacks. 3 Press INPUT to select Video 3 to view the program. Note: VIDEO2 and VIDEO3 jacks have identical functions. Compatible video devices can be connected to either or both set of jacks. HELP HINTS (PROBLEMS/SOLUTIONS) SYMPTOM "No Signal" will appear randomly on the screen when no signal is detected at the video jack. CHECK THESE CONDITIONS G Check Audio / Video connections. G Check external equipment connections. G Check external equipment setting. TRY THESE SOLUTIONS G Press the INPUT key. G Switch on external equipment. G Set external equipment output connections to match input connections. If you continue to experience problems, please call toll free 1-800-877-5032. We can Help! 19
